Yellow Flamingos Led By Nevisian Carlon Bowens Tuckett Win In Under 19 Trials

The Yellow Flamingos engaged the Blue Dolphins in the grand finals of the West Indies under 19 trial matches, being played in Antigua, on Saturday 14th August.

The Flamingos were once again led by Carlon Bowles Tuckett of Nevis.

The Blue Dolphins batted first and were right away undermined by the seam and swing generated by Nathan Edwards of St. Maarten, to be pegged back very early in their innings.

Later on, M. Clarke bowled a devastating spell, to bag 4 wickets for just 8 runs, which later earned him the man of the match award.

The Dolphins were bowled out for just 76.

Carlon Bowens Tuckett was fantastic behind the stumps, taking a couple of superlative catches.

The Flamingos, stumbled slightly in their response, as Nevisian Justin Amurdan failed to get off to a good score, this time around, but eventually wiped off the required target in just 15 overs, for the loss of 1 wicket, with Bishop leading the way, with an undefeated half century.

The original 56 member trial squad has been reduced to 25. We are awaiting official word as to the selectees. That 25 will later be reduced to the 18, to be selected for the upcoming tour to the UK.

Summarized scores: Blue Dolphins 76 all out in 25 overs: Arnold 19; Jagessar 1

Clarke 4 for 8; Nathan Edwards 3 for 18

Flamingos 80 for 1 in 15 overs: T. Bishop 51*; A. Browne 8

Flamingos won by 9 wickets
